What Is Libel and Slander Law?
Libel and slander are forms of defamation that involve telling lies or misrepresentations about another person. Defamation can hurt your reputation, damage your relationships, and cause you to lose your job. Libel involves false written statements. Slander is a false spoken statement.
To prove libel or slander, the other person has to make a false statement they knew or reasonably knew was false. To recover damages, you have to show that the defamatory statement caused damage or harm to your reputation.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Libel and Slander Lawyer?
Libel and slander are bad for business owners and private citizens alike. Some of the following are examples of libel and slander:
- A fake restaurant review complaining of rats
- A social media post or review accusing a business of selling faulty or unsafe products
- Publishing a news article with clear, provable untruths about someone
- Making a false accusation in a speech or business meeting
- Spreading false rumors about someone

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Personal Injury Lawyer?
If you don’t hire a personal injury lawyer, you might struggle to get fair compensation for your injuries. Without legal guidance, you could miss important deadlines to file a lawsuit, fail to gather the right evidence, or be taken advantage of by insurance companies. This might result in accepting a settlement offer that is less than what you need to cover medical bills, lost wages, and other expenses. A lawyer helps protect your rights, builds a strong case, and negotiates on your behalf, increasing your chances of getting the most possible compensation.
